The Yale Security Assure Lock 2 with Wi-Fi in Satin Nickel offers a variety of keyless entry options, including keypad, voice assistant, Auto-Unlock, and the Yale Access App, making it versatile for different user preferences. It ensures connectivity through both Wi-Fi and Bluetooth, which is handy for remote access and control. The lock can integrate with popular smart home systems like Apple HomeKit, Google Assistant, and Amazon Alexa, adding to its convenience.
For security, it features Auto-Lock and the ability to share unlimited temporary codes via the app, which can be useful for family members or service providers. The included DoorSense technology provides peace of mind by confirming whether the door is closed and locked. However, users should note that it requires 4 AA batteries, which are included but need periodic replacement, potentially leading to maintenance concerns. Its installation process is straightforward with all necessary hardware supplied, but it requires compatibility with U.S. or Canadian systems, limiting its use internationally.
The lock's design is sleek and modern, fitting well with most home aesthetics. This smart lock is best suited for those who prioritize convenience, remote access, and integration with existing smart home systems.
The Yale Assure Lock 2 Touch Deadbolt offers a key-free smart entry solution with several advanced features, making it an attractive choice for those seeking convenience and security. Its fingerprint scanner stands out, offering a secure and quick way to unlock your door, claiming 99% accuracy and recognition time of less than 0.5 seconds. The lock also supports auto-unlock as you approach, which is great if your hands are full, and auto-lock so you never have to worry about forgetting to secure your home.
Additionally, the Yale Access app allows you to control the lock remotely, share access, and receive notifications, enhancing convenience and security. For installation, it’s designed to replace your existing deadbolt using just a screwdriver, which means you don't need any DIY experience or a locksmith to set it up. The lock works with popular smart home systems like Apple HomeKit, Google Assistant, and Amazon Alexa, adding flexibility in how you interact with it.
It operates on 2.4 GHz Wi-Fi, and its compatibility is limited to the U.S. and Canada. Its sleek black suede design and compact dimensions make it a stylish addition to any front door. Despite its relatively high price, the Yale Assure Lock 2 Touch Deadbolt is well-suited for those wanting a blend of advanced features and ease of use in a smart lock.
The Yale Assure Lock 2 Touch Deadbolt is designed to make keyless entry straightforward and secure, especially useful for vacation rental hosts. It offers multiple entry options including a touchscreen keypad, a fingerprint scanner with fast and accurate recognition, and traditional keyed entry as a backup. The lock connects wirelessly through the included Yale Connect Wi-Fi Bridge, allowing you to control access remotely via the Yale Access app. This lets you share unique, temporary door codes with guests for easy check-ins without worrying about lost keys or lockboxes.
Security is strong with features like two-factor authentication, a keypad resistant to fingerprint smudges, and automatic locking when the door closes, helping prevent accidental unlocks. The lock’s battery-powered operation ensures it keeps working even during power or Wi-Fi outages, and if batteries run out, you can still use the physical key. Installation is user-friendly, replacing your existing deadbolt with just a screwdriver for most standard US doors, so no special tools or locksmiths are required.
The lock keeps a detailed activity feed so you can track who enters and when—a handy feature for remote monitoring. Compatibility with smartphones, tablets, and platforms like Airbnb adds flexibility, making it a solid choice if you want smart, secure, and convenient control over your door access. Although it may be pricier than basic locks and requires periodic battery replacements, and the Wi-Fi Bridge needs a nearby power outlet which might limit placement options, this Yale lock is a reliable option for managing rentals or enhancing door security with convenience.
